Requirements
  • 2+ years of experience supporting launches of a live, public product
  • Incident management process expertise
  • Effective communication skills and experience working in a cross-functional organization
  • General comfort working with visualization tools and metrics
  • You thrive in a fast-paced environment
  • You have a knack for customer advocacy
Responsibilities
  • Operate and continually improve major incident management processes and tooling, from initial identification through to resolution and influencing systems design principles across the company
  • Participate in an on-call rotation that extends coverage in assisting and supporting service owners during off-hours
  • Interface with telemetry and monitoring systems to understand the health of critical business services
  • Contribute to systems and services that help us with operational excellence and automated workflows
  • Develop best practices across our organization and tools that help us distribute those
  • Guide development teams on understanding systems and helping them be successful with service ownership
  • Guide service owners in risk reduction and major launch preparation

Epic Games develops and publishes popular video games, including "Fortnite" and "Unreal Tournament," available on various platforms like iOS, Android, and PC. The company also provides Epic Online Services, which offer tools for other developers to manage and scale their games, including backend support and online multiplayer features. Unlike its competitors, Epic Games not only creates games but also shares its technology, such as the Unreal Engine, which many developers use. The goal of Epic Games is to enhance gaming experiences for players while empowering developers with the necessary tools and support.
